the firmware version does not have anything to do with the radars performance. just done by escort incase they need to repair a unit so they know what parts to use
Originally Posted by Escort Customer Service
It is good to hear from you. Revisions are not only based on software but for us are linked directly to hardware. Any change in components, suppliers, or software changes require a revision. Most revisions are for internal technical support and will not be recognized by the end user. The last revision added internal memory on our flash chip so the Repair Technicians will have a log of any calibration failures and other historical data to make repairs easier. Our Customer Service Department does not keep track of the revision numbers, because they will have no effect on performance or features.
